Chair in Law and Professional Ethics
12 December 2011
The Law Faculty has created a new Chair in Law and Professional Ethics, supporting the ongoing progress of the Centre for Ethics and Law. The Chair is expected to commence in September 2012 and will take on the role of Centre Director.
The role was advertised and candidates were interviewed in November. It is expected that a decision will be made shortly.
